09:14 — Rollout of the Lanternfall flag framework hit 25% of traffic when we noticed stale flag evaluations on the Dunmoor edge nodes. Turned out the signing cache wasn't invalidating on config push — worth a security review, since stale flags could re-enable a killed feature. We froze the rollout and patched the cache. The patched build's trace token is recorded below.

build token for kagaf-hahof: htk14_9d3d4d26d7d8de

## Releases — VramScope GPU Profiler

Tag releases from main only. The profiler's kernel-hook module is version-locked to the driver matrix in `compat.toml`; update it before tagging. CI builds, packages, and signs the module automatically, but local release builds must sign manually. Builds are signed with the maintainer key shown below.

rollout seal: bky19_M1Zvn1YQwEBTy4XxP3H

Subject: Cron drift cut-over — done (mostly)

Hey team,

We finished the cut-over for the Tumblewick scheduler last night. The drift investigation confirmed the old host's clock was skewing ~40s per day, which explains the missed midnight runs. Jobs now run on the Pellacor cluster with NTP properly pinned. Please route any "job didn't fire" tickets to the scheduling queue for the next week. For reference, here are the settings the new scheduler runs with.

config for kafof-bawef:
holath:
  log_level: debug
  metrics_host: metrics.holath.qorvelsys.internal
  pin: 2191
  pool_size: 32

Hi folks,

Quick update from the Forgekite team: we're moving the plugin build to Hermeta, our hermetic build system, next sprint. Your plugins should mostly just work, but you'll need to re-fetch dependencies through the sealed proxy. To register your plugin with the proxy, authenticate using the token below.

session JWT of yawep-yawep = eyJhbGciOiJIUzI1NiIsInR5cCI6IkpXVCJ9.eyJzdWIiOiI3pWF3_In0.aXYsHiog

Heads up, plugin folks: the Marwick SDK 3.1 token refresher sometimes drops sessions mid-call, which can lock your dev account. Don't spam retries — that trips the limiter. Instead, run the recovery tool from the plugin console. It'll ask for the shared recovery passphrase, which you'll find just below.

unlock words, hahap-yawig: pelix-kelion-tamys-jorix-julok